Flights and Shafts

Flights and shafts affect the dart’s stability and trajectory. Smaller flights provide less drag and are suitable for players with a fast, accurate throw. Larger flights offer more stability and are better for players who need more control. Shaft length also influences the dart’s flight path. Shorter shafts tend to make the dart fly straighter, while longer shafts provide more stability. Experiment with different combinations to find the optimal setup for your throwing style.

  • Flights: Try standard, kite, slim, and vortex flights to see what feels best.
  • Shafts: Experiment with nylon, aluminum, and rotating shafts in various lengths.

Target Practice

Focus on hitting specific targets on the dartboard. Start with larger targets, such as the 20 segment, and gradually work your way down to smaller targets, such as the double and triple rings. This drill helps improve your accuracy and consistency.

  • 20s Only: Throw all your darts at the 20 segment.
  • Around the Clock: Throw one dart at each number in sequence, from 1 to 20.
  • Doubles Practice: Focus on hitting the double ring for each number.

Scoring Tactics

Develop a strategic approach to scoring in different games. In 501, for example, plan your throws to set up favorable finishing combinations. Avoid leaving yourself with awkward numbers that are difficult to check out. Knowing why rotate dartboard is also important for even wear.

  • Learn common checkouts: Master combinations like 40 (double 20), 32 (double 16), and 50 (bullseye).
  • Plan your route to the finish: Aim to leave yourself with a checkout that you’re comfortable with.
